A falafel sandwich provides 220 calories per 100 g. It contains 6.5 g of protein, 32 g of carbohydrates, and 7.5 g of fat per 100 g.
Falafel sandwich is compatible with vegan, vegetarian, Mediterranean, flexitarian, and omnivore diets. It contains gluten and sesame, so it is not suitable for people with these allergies.
